I have 15 poults that are 5 days old. All but one appear to be in excellent health. The one is just laying on the floor swaying back and forth. I cannot get it to eat or drink. Should I seperate it from the others to prevent it infecting the others? Other sites tell me to cull it. Any advice would be appreciated.
 
At that age I wouldn't be so worried about it being able to infect the others so much.
It sounds like it may just be a failure to thrive.

Since it's not eating on it's own, if you don't tube feed it, or do something similar (not even sure what would be considered similar) it will die.

I have been trying to get it to drink using a medicine dropper and made a mash of the feed with water and still cannot get it to eat or drink. It finally pooped a really watery stool that was brown tinted. Still laying there lethargic. It cannot walk, just hobbles around. I found it laying upside down on its back and turned it over. Gonna try feeding it again in a little bit.

turtling is not good.. put it in a cup so it can't flip over... I would give it a drop or 2 of nutridrech https://www.tractorsupply.com/tsc/product/nutri-drench-poultry-4-oz in the mouth
